SOCIÉTÉ GÉNÉRALE
FINAL TERMS DATED 18 APRIL 2017
Issue of USD 100,000,000 Senior Preferred Floating Rate Notes due April 2018 (the Notes)
under the €50,000,000,000 Euro Medium Term Note – Paris Registered Programme (the Programme) Series no.: PA 066/17-04
Tranche no.: 1
Issue Price: 100.00 per cent.
Citigroup Global Markets Limited
PART A – CONTRACTUAL TERMS
The Notes have not been, and will not be, registered under the U.S. Securities Act of 1933, as amended (the Securities Act), or with any securities regulatory authority of any state or other jurisdiction of the United States and may not be offered or sold within the United States or for the account or benefit of U.S. Persons (as defined in Regulation S under the Securities Act), except in certain transactions exempt from the registration requirements of the Securities Act. For a description of certain restrictions on offers and sales of Notes, see section headed "Subscription and Sale" in the Base Prospectus.
Terms used herein shall be deemed to be defined as such for the purposes of the conditions (the Conditions) set forth under the heading "Terms and Conditions of the English Law Notes" in the base prospectus dated 9 January 2017 which received visa no.17-008 on 9 January 2017 from the Autorité des marchés financiers (the AMF), as supplemented by the supplements dated 13 February 2017 and 10 March 2017 which received visa no. 17-057 and 17-091 from the AMF on 13 February 2017 and 10 March 2017, respectively (together, the Base Prospectus), which together constitute a base prospectus for the purposes of Directive 2003/71/EC of the European Parliament and of the Council dated 4 November 2003 on the prospectus to be published when securities are offered to the public or admitted to trading, as amended (the Prospectus Directive).
This document constitutes the final terms of the Notes (the Final Terms) described herein for the purposes of Article 5.4 of the Prospectus Directive and must be read in conjunction with the Base Prospectus. Full information on the Issuer and the offer of the Notes is only available on the basis of the combination of these Final Terms and the Base Prospectus. Copies of the Base Prospectus and these Final Terms are available for inspection and obtainable, upon request and free of charge, during usual business hours on any weekday from the head office of the Issuer and the specified offices of the Paying Agents. So long as Notes are outstanding, those documents will also be available on the websites of the AMF (www.amf-france.org) and of the Issuer (http://prospectus.socgen.com).

| 14. | Floating Rate Note Provisions | Applicable |
- (i) Specified Period(s) (see Condition 4(b)(i)(B) of the Terms and Conditions of the English Law Notes and Condition 3(b)(i)(B) of the Terms and Conditions of the French Law Notes/Interest Payment Date(s): 20 January, 20 April, 20 July and 20 October in each year commencing on 20 July 2017 (until and including the Interest Payment Date scheduled to fall on or nearest to 20 April 2018), subject in each case to adjustment pursuant to the Business Day Convention specified below.
- (ii) Business Day Convention: Modified Following Business Day Convention
- (iii) Additional Business Centre(s): London, New York
- (iv) Manner in which the Rate of Interest and Interest Amount is to be determined: Screen Rate Determination
- (v) Party responsible for calculating the Rate of Interest and/or Interest Amount (if not the Calculation Agent): Not Applicable
(vi) Screen Rate Determination:
| - | Reference Rate: | 3-month USD LIBOR-ICE |
|---|---|---|
| - | Interest Determination Date(s): | Second London business day prior to the start of each Interest Period |
| - | Specified Time: | 11.00 a.m. London time |
| - | Relevant Screen Page: | Reuters LIBOR01 |
| - | Reference Banks: | As selected by the Fiscal Agent |
| (vii) | ISDA Determination: | Not Applicable |
| (viii) | Margin(s): | + 0.33 per cent. per annum |
| (ix) | Minimum Rate of Interest: | Zero (0) per cent. per annum |
| (x) | Maximum Rate of Interest: | Not Applicable |
| (xi) | Day Count Fraction: | Actual/360 |
| (xii) | Rate Multiplier: | Not Applicable |
